![linux – 用于检查公共HTTPS站点是否已启动的Bash脚本,第1张 linux – 用于检查公共HTTPS站点是否已启动的Bash脚本,第1张](/aiimages/linux+%E2%80%93+%E7%94%A8%E4%BA%8E%E6%A3%80%E6%9F%A5%E5%85%AC%E5%85%B1HTTPS%E7%AB%99%E7%82%B9%E6%98%AF%E5%90%A6%E5%B7%B2%E5%90%AF%E5%8A%A8%E7%9A%84Bash%E8%84%9A%E6%9C%AC.png)
概述我正在尝试为bash
脚本设置另一个代码块,以
检查HTTPS上的公共网站是否已启动.我们可以使用CURL吗?任何建议除了CURL之外还可以使用什么.谢谢 这是一种使用wget而不是curl来实现它的方法.请记住,默认情况下MacOS没有附带wget. 成功的Web请求将返回200的代码,失败将返回300,400,404等…(请参阅REST API codes) 如果Web请求成功,此行将返回1,否则 我正在尝试为bash脚本设置另一个代码块,以检查httpS上的公共网站是否已启动.我们可以使用CURL吗?任何建议除了CURL之外还可以使用什么.谢谢解决方法 这是一种使用wget而不是curl来实现它的方法.请记住,默认情况下MacOS没有附带wget.
成功的Web请求将返回200的代码,失败将返回300,400,404等…(请参阅REST API codes)
如果Web请求成功,此行将返回1,否则返回0
wget -q -O /tmp/foo Google.com | grep '200' /tmp/foo | wc -l1
总结
以上是内存溢出为你收集整理的linux – 用于检查公共HTTPS站点是否已启动的Bash脚本全部内容,希望文章能够帮你解决linux – 用于检查公共HTTPS站点是否已启动的Bash脚本所遇到的程序开发问题。
如果觉得内存溢出网站内容还不错,欢迎将内存溢出网站推荐给程序员好友。
评论列表(0条)